PsiQuantum’s mission is to build the first useful quantum computers—machines capable of delivering the breakthroughs the field has long promised. Since our founding in 2016, our singular focus has been to build and deploy million-qubit, fault-tolerant quantum systems.   Quantum computers harness the laws of quantum mechanics to solve problems that even the most advanced supercomputers or AI systems will never reach. Their impact will span energy, pharmaceuticals, finance, agriculture, transportation, materials, and other foundational industries.   Our architecture and approach is based on silicon photonics. By leveraging the advanced semiconductor manufacturing industry—including partners like GlobalFoundries—we use the same high-volume processes that already produce billions of chips for telecom and consumer electronics. Photonics offers natural advantages for scale: photons don’t feel heat, are immune to electromagnetic interference, and integrate with existing cryogenic cooling and standard fiber-optic infrastructure.   In 2024, PsiQuantum announced government-funded projects to support the build-out of our first utility-scale quantum computers in Brisbane, Australia, and Chicago, Illinois. These initiatives reflect a growing recognition that quantum computing will be strategically and economically defining—and that now is the time to scale.   PsiQuantum also develops the algorithms and software needed to make these systems commercially valuable. Our application, software, and industry teams work directly with leading Fortune 500 companies—including Lockheed Martin, Mercedes-Benz, Boehringer Ingelheim, and Mitsubishi Chemical—to prepare quantum solutions for real-world impact.   Quantum computing is not an extension of classical computing. It represents a fundamental shift—and a path to mastering challenges that cannot be solved any other way. The potential is enormous, and we have a clear path to make it real.   Come join us.   Job Summary: PsiQuantum is seeking a Quantum Electronics Engineer to support the development of advanced electronic and electro-optic systems for quantum computing. In this role, you will work closely with senior engineers to design and implement high-performance electronic solutions for controlling and reading out quantum photonic hardware. This includes RF design, electro-optic modulation, and low-latency control systems. Responsibilities: Design and develop RF and high-speed electronic systems for quantum hardware applications. Support the design of electro-optic (EO) packages and modulator driving electronics. Develop low-latency electronic solutions for quantum system control and readout. Work on readout systems for superconducting nanowire single-photon detectors (SNSPDs). Collaborate with photonics and quantum teams to integrate electronics with optical systems. Assist in FPGA-based system design and implementation for control and data acquisition. Participate in debugging and optimization of complex quantum hardware systems. Experience/Qualifications: Degree (PhD or equivalent experience) in Electrical Engineering, Physics, or a related field. Strong background in RF and high-speed electronic design. Experience working with electro-optic systems or photonic hardware. Understanding of signal integrity, noise, and timing in high-performance systems. Hands-on laboratory experience with electronic test and measurement equipment. Desired Skills: Experience designing electronics for quantum or cryogenic systems. Familiarity with FPGA development and programming. Knowledge of superconducting nanowire detectors and readout electronics. Experience with low-latency system design and high-speed data acquisition. Experience with ASIC design or collaboration with ASIC development teams for high-speed or low-latency electronic systems.
